MONTHLY BOOKKEEPING

Our monthly bookkeeping and compliance service allows you to simply deposit your money into the bank and pay your bills. We will prepare the following:

  • Income Journals

  • Disbursement Journals

  • General Ledgers

  • Payroll Journals

  • Statements of Financial Position

  • Revenue & Expense Statements

Not only will you be assured that your financial statements are being prepared accurately according to General Accepted Accounting Principles, you can be at peace that you will be in 100% compliance with all IRS and state requirements governing 501(c)(3) tax exempt organizations.

Our team will prepare all required filings, including:

  • Forms 941s

  • Forms W-2

  • Forms W-3

  • Forms 1099s

  • Form 1096

  • Any Additional Require Forms

MONTHLY PAYROLL SERVICES

With our specialized payroll processing services, our team will:

  • Prepare your employee’s paychecks

  • Calculate the required tax withholdings

  • Remit tax withholdings to the IRS, state and another agency required

  • Direct Deposit paychecks into the employee’s bank account

Never again will you be burdened with penalties for late payment of payroll taxes. Our specialized payroll service does not require any input from you. Once we have all the necessary pay information for each employee, we can generate your payroll for each pay period without any additional effort on your part.
